Sat 1245076262439107

decimal
288030.1262439107
degree
0°78030′1758″1262439107‴
percentile
59.28934589565198%
name
fakxeuegbbi
cycle
0
epoch
1
period
142
block
288030
offset
1262439107
timestamp
rarity
common